I've done several signed player runs, though all of ,mine are 1960s football. I agree with Mike in that if Robinson is such a willing signer, then try and tackle them in the way that Mike suggests. That way you are pretty much guaranteed a quality end product. If you pick them up on the fly, then you will ultimately have mixed ink signatures, and have to "settle" on card condition when you finally find a signed example of some of his more difficult issues (1967 Topps).
